# RestockRoute client setup
#
# This block wires up the client for Snacktrak, our vending-machine
# restock planner. Support folks: if a machine shows stale inventory,
# it's almost always this client failing auth, not the planner itself.
# The client talks to the Fillwise internal API on every planning run,
# so a bad key means zero routes generated and a lot of empty slots.
# Keys rotate quarterly; grab the current one from the vault if this
# one stops working. The key currently in use is pasted just below.

gateway credential: kto3_qfe

## Who to ping about GiftNote

Welcome aboard! GiftNote is our donation-receipt mailer for the Larchfield Fund. Template tweaks go to the comms folks; delivery failures and bounce weirdness go to the platform crew. Don't push template changes on Fridays — receipts batch over the weekend. For anything GiftNote-related, start with the address below.

billing contact of kaweg-tajeg = drudor.lamion.oliath@torvalabs.test

# Restock Planner Approvals

All restock plans generated by SnackRoute must be approved before dispatch. Support cannot approve plans directly. Plans under 50 units auto-approve overnight; larger plans need manual sign-off within 24 hours. If a customer reports a stalled plan, check the approvals queue first, then the machine's region flag. Do not re-trigger generation; duplicates corrupt the route cache. Stuck approvals should be forwarded to the approver named below.

named custodian: Oliath Ralax

Subject: Ownership change — Corvid MQ log compaction

Reviewer,

Compaction logic for Corvid MQ is moving out of the core broker module into its own package. Expect a series of small PRs over two weeks; please hold broker-side compaction changes until the split lands. Review standards unchanged. Going forward, all compaction reviews route through the new responsible engineer.

approver of yawig-yajef = Briius Jorix

**Release checklist — Harborview 4.2: zero-downtime schema step**

- [ ] Confirm the `orders_v2` table migration follows expand-contract: new columns are nullable, backfill job `hv-backfill` has completed, and dual writes are verified in the Quillmont staging cluster before the contract phase. Future maintainers: never merge the contract PR in the same release as the expand PR; keep one full deploy cycle between them. Record the verification build token beneath this item.

session token of tajef-bageg = htk21_5d90d574934f3ccae6437